A ‘Clueless’ television series is under way at Peacock, Alicia Silverstone to reprise her iconic role

Ugh as if!

Alicia Silverstone is officially stepping back into her iconic plaid skirt as Cher Horowitz in a brand-new Clueless television series, now in development at Peacock.

Based on the beloved 1995 teen comedy, the new series is being crafted by Gossip Girl creators Josh Schwartz and Stephanie Savage, along with Dollface creator Jordan Weiss.

Silverstone isn’t just reprising her role—she’s also stepping into the role of executive producer, joined by the film’s original director and writer Amy Heckerling and producer Robert Lawrence.

This isn’t the first time a Clueless revival has been in the works. A previous attempt in 2020 centered around Dionne fizzled out, but Peacock is giving the franchise another go, this time with Cher at the forefront once more.

The original Clueless was a witty, ultra-stylish spin on Jane Austen’s Emma, turning Cher into a fashion-forward, well-meaning Beverly Hills teen navigating high school, matchmaking, and self-discovery.

It became an instant classic, spawning a TV spin-off in the late ’90s that ran for three seasons.

Plot details for the new series are still tightly under wraps, but it promises to continue Cher’s story.

Silverstone’s return follows her surprise revival of the character in a Super Bowl commercial two years ago that sent fans into a nostalgic frenzy.

Since her Clueless breakout, Silverstone has starred in films like Batman & Robin, Blast from the Past, and Beauty Shop, and earned critical acclaim for her recent TV work in American Horror Stories, The Baby-Sitters Club, and American Woman.

Up next, she’s starring in the Yorgos Lanthimos-directed Bugonia and producing and appearing in the Acorn TV series Irish Blood.

With Silverstone back in the driver’s seat and the OG creative team reuniting, this reboot could be anything but clueless.
